Diablo 4 With Ray Tracing

It was NVIDIA that said some time ago that it was working on the latest technology for the upcoming gaming projects. It turns out that it was about the ray tracing technology, and now we are ready to welcome Diablo 4 with ray tracing.

NVIDIA has now finally provided a confirmed release date for the Diablo 4 with ray tracing during its CES 2024 digital event. Now, this amazing graphic tech technology is ready to arrive with one of Blizzard’s famous action RPG dungeon crawler games later this month.

NVIDIA shared a blog post recently revealing that Diablo 4 with ray tracing is arriving on March 26. Moreover, what’s more exciting is that this update for the game is set to be launched just two days before Diablo 4 is scheduled for release on Xbox’s subscription service.

We all know that ray tracing is a new graphic technology that is becoming common in modern-day games today. It is a brilliant technique that has the potential to create lifelike lighting, reflections, and shadows for PC games that can support this technology or feature.

Now, in the case of Diablo 4, various elements like water and armor will have ray-traced reflections to offer more realistic visuals while you play. In addition, if you have an NVIDIA GeForce RTX graphics card in your rig, the game will become more beautiful and realistic.

But Diablo 4 with ray tracing is not the only thing you should be interested in, because there are more. The game already has DLSS 3 support, which is the third generation of NVIDIA’s excellent technology.
